Output 769e3600dddccbcd9288d945265d3c6206deb800f9f10028b3683b90e2520486:2

value
20900957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46775eb0988128ae29f8dc956d3f35061999bae1 OP_EQUAL
address
MEKkXphGSKobSySoGyFfMfKf86X2ALpD84
transaction
769e3600dddccbcd9288d945265d3c6206deb800f9f10028b3683b90e2520486
spent
true